Here's my suggestion for getting the most you can out of the Literotica author's community to help you:

First, take a small chunk of this story, and write a short story based on that chunk. Make it short so you can get it done, but long enough to have a beginning, middle, and end. Maybe 8,000 to 10,000 words. Do the best you can. Use some of the "how to" writing guides that have been published here to help you. Try hard to get the grammar and punctuation and spelling as good as you can. When it's done, submit it to the Feedback Forum and ask for advice.

Second, in the meantime, read stories here. Find authors you like. Perhaps reach out directly to authors you think can help you.

You find MUCH more help doing it this way than trying to enlist someone to help you with a huge writing project.

I have one other suggestion, meant to be constructive. In all the writing you submit at this Site, whether in the form of stories or in comments in forums, use the most correct format and style you can. Capitalize the first letter of sentences. Write in complete sentences. Use periods at the end of sentences. Use commas where appropriate. Don't skimp on these things.

I realize that many contributors contribute via phone, and it's simpler to omit punctuation and capitals, but it really does affect the way people will view and evaluate what you write. They will be less willing to work with you if they feel like you are lazy with your writing and not trying your best. I've done a little bit of editing with other Literotica writers, and I have vowed I will not edit anything contributed to me by an author if I do not feel the author has submitted what they honestly believe is their best work. You owe it to an editor to do that before submitting it for editing. You will also learn much more about how to write well if at each stage you are giving it your best shot.
